I recently picked up a ton of Barefoots for the dead of next winter. I popped a bag into the XXV to play with settings, and was surprised by pellet length. The pic below shows one just shy of 2.25 inches -- while that's the longest I found, many were near 1.75 inches.
I've read about bridging on these forums, and that worries me. I swear I hear my auger breaking up the longer pellets as it turns. Maybe that's in my head?
Are these pellets too long? Or am I just bored by spring and making up potential problems?
